We stopped off for a sandwich at the Smugglers today. It was really busy because of the lovely weather and the barman told me the number of punters had taken them all by surprise. The beer - Badger Best - was kept really well. We were a bit surprised that they did not do sandwiches, as they stick to what is on the generic Ringwood menu, but we had the very pleasant larder board to share. But we think there should have been more bread, and bigger cheese portions for the price (about £12). If we hadn;t ordered a side bowl of chips we would have felt short changed. the chips were lovely and the food came quickly. It was a lovely place to sit in the sunshine, it's family friendly so lots of children were having a whale of a time on the swings. We availed ourselves of the free newspapers and had a lovely relaxing lunch. I would recommend it!
